Abstract

In the labor-intensive cell production system, it is important to train operators effectively because their skills are essential for productivity. Our previous study proposed a method to classify the skills named "skill index" based on the time required for each task and allocated operators based on this method. However, in actual workplaces, it is assumed that workers accumulate fatigue due to the repetition of work, which affects the operation time. In this study, we propose an operator’s allocation method that considers the effect of fatigue and verify its effectiveness compared with the results of the previous study by computer experiments. In addition, an assembly experiment using a toy is conducted using the worker allocation method obtained by the computer experiments.
